Subject: [PATCH v2] selftests: cachestat: Refactor test to remove duplication
From: Suresh K C <suresh.k.chandrappa@...il.com>
Refactored the mmap and shmem test logic into a common function
to reduce code duplication and improve maintainability
Changes in v2:
Refactored mmap and shmem tests into a common function
Renamed test function to run_cachestat_test()
Removed test for /proc/cpuinfo as a general /proc test case already exists
Signed-off-by: Suresh K C <suresh.k.chandrappa@...il.com>
---
.../selftests/cachestat/test_cachestat.c | 97 ++++++-------------
1 file changed, 30 insertions(+), 67 deletions(-)
